CELL VOLTAGE MONITORING AND SELF-CALIBRATING DEVICE

1. A cell voltage monitoring and self-calibrating device for a plurality of battery cells, comprising:

  • a first voltage measurement unit, for measuring voltages of a first battery cell and a second battery cell;

    a second voltage measurement unit, for measuring voltages of a second battery cell and a third battery cell;

    a first compensation unit, connected to the first voltage measurement unit, for adjusting the voltages of the first and second battery cells by multiplying the measured voltages of the first and second battery cells by a first compensation value;

    a second compensation unit, connected to the second voltage measurement unit, for adjusting the voltages of the second and third battery cells by multiplying the measured voltages of the second and third battery cells by a second compensation value; and

    a calculating unit, connected to the first voltage measurement unit, the second voltage measurement unit, the first compensation unit and the second compensation unit, for calculating the first compensation value and the second compensation value based on the voltages of the second battery cell measured by the first voltage measurement unit and the second voltage measurement unit such that the voltages of the second battery cell will be the same after being adjusted by the first compensation unit and the second compensation unit, thereby systematic measurement errors of each battery cells can be combined into a single variable for self-calibration.
